1. Introduction A fetal disorder resulting from a transverse lie during labor presents one of the most absolute and perilous mechanical obstructions in modern obstetrics. A transverse lie occurs when the long axis of the fetus is positioned perpendicular to the long axis of the maternal uterus, meaning the fetus is lying horizontally across the … Read more
